Software courses can help you learn programming languages like Python, Java, and JavaScript, along with concepts such as algorithms, data structures, and software development methodologies. You can build skills in version control, debugging, and testing, which are crucial for creating reliable applications. Many courses introduce tools like Git for collaboration, integrated development environments (IDEs) for coding, and frameworks such as React or Django for building user interfaces and backend systems.
